What is Artificial Intelligence?

What is Artificial Intelligence? Expert system, often abbreviated as AI, refers to the simulation of human intelligence procedures by devices, specifically computer system systems. These procedures include discovering, reasoning, and self-correction.

AI has a fascinating history, dating back to the mid-20th century when the initial AI programs were established. For many years, AI has evolved considerably, causing various sorts of AI systems, such as narrow AI, general AI, and superintelligent AI.

Secret components of AI consist of formulas, data, and computational power.

A subset of AI, called machine learning, concentrates on developing algorithms that allow computers to learn from and make forecasts or choices based on data. Within machine learning, deep understanding stands out as a specific type that uses semantic networks to mimic the means the human brain jobs.

Machine learning and deep learning have actually revolutionized numerous markets, from health care to finance, by improving automation, anticipating analytics, and personalization."

In Finance

In the money industry, AI is essential in fraud detection, risk administration, and algorithmic trading, allowing even more protected and effective monetary operations.

In regards to AI applications in financial services, the usage instances vary and impactful. For example, in credit scoring, AI models such as arbitrary woodlands and slope enhancing formulas are typically employed to examine data and assess credit reliability much more precisely and swiftly. These models can process large quantities of data points and deal backgrounds to anticipate the probability of default.

Customer service chatbots driven by natural language processing (NLP) techniques like reoccurring semantic networks (RNNs) are revolutionizing customer interactions. They provide immediate responses to questions, automate regular jobs, and individualize consumer experiences.

Ethical Concerns

Ethical worries in AI revolve around problems such as prejudice, fairness, openness, and responsibility, which can significantly impact the reliability and societal acceptance of AI innovations.

One significant ethical issue in AI is mathematical predisposition, where AI systems might accidentally discriminate against particular teams based upon biased information or flawed algorithms. This can lead to unfair outcomes in different fields such as employing, loaning, and healthcare.

Lack of transparency more worsens these worries, as it becomes hard to comprehend just how decisions are made by AI systems. The difficulty of liability occurs when AI makes crucial decisions without clear lines of responsibility.

To resolve these difficulties, numerous efforts and frameworks have actually been introduced to advertise moral AI development. For instance, companies like the Partnership on AI and the IEEE have developed guidelines and concepts to make certain that AI modern technologies are developed and made use of in a responsible and moral way.

The advancement of AI principles boards within business and regulative bodies assists in examining the moral implications of AI applications and fostering liability. By thinking about these honest concerns and implementing proper frameworks, we can function in the direction of building AI systems that are fair, clear, and answerable to all stakeholders.
